An ultrasonogram of the KUB (Kidneys, Ureters, and Bladder) and PVR (Post-Void Residual) is a non-invasive imaging procedure used to assess the urinary system. The KUB ultrasound evaluates the kidneys, ureters, and bladder for conditions such as kidney stones, infections, or bladder abnormalities like blockages. The PVR measures the amount of urine left in the bladder after urination, helping to identify urinary retention or bladder dysfunction. The procedure involves applying gel to the skin and using a transducer to capture real-time images. It is painless, requires no special preparation, and provides valuable diagnostic insights into urinary health.
